Kano Records First Coronavirus Death by Dareypaul: 8:30am On Apr 16, 2020 |
Kano State has recorded first COVID-19 death on Wednesday. The state ministry of health confirmed this in a tweet at 11.55 pm. Kano on Wednesday confirmed 12 new cases of COVID-19, hence with a total of 21 confirmed cases in the state. As at 11:55 pm Kano State recorded their first death just 10 minutes after recording 12 cases in the state. Currently, In Nigeria 34 New Cases were Confirmed last night making it a total of 407 and 128 Discharged, 12 Deaths. Wednesday, 15th April 2020.
